                                             in question will have a to-
                            W tal  electricity generation ca-             requirements of the latest
                            pacity of 780 MW and an energy performance of   generation H-Class gas turbine
                            63%,  the  highest  output  currently  available  from
                            technologies. This will translate into a 40% reduc-
                            tion of specifi c carbon emissions compared to the
